func (Depth) GetPackedLayer

func (d Depth) GetPackedLayer() (layer int32)

GetPackedLayer Segment depth into specific layers, leaving 2^16 for first, at least 2^8 for second (and 2^8 for third), if no third it'll use whole for second TODO: handle higher depths gracefully It is known layers CAN overlap, TODO: check if limiting range might make sense? TODO: change this to a truly dynamic mode. might need 2-pass to check for hole overlap libass reads this onto an int32, TODO it overflows onto negative? Additionally the order of fields has extra read order. earlier lines have lower effective layer than later lines, if layers are equal
